CLEVELAND, TN – The UVA Wise men's and women's track and field teams opened the outdoor season with a strong showing at the two-day Lee University Invitational, combining multiple school records with a wide range of top-10 performances across event groups.
WOMEN'S HIGHLIGHTS
- The Cavalier women opened the outdoor season with impact performances across sprints, distance, hurdles, and field events, highlighted by several school records and top-10 finishes.
- On the track,
Madison Sutherland set a new school record in the 100 meters (12.52) while placing fifth and leading a strong sprint group that also saw
Destiny Ansley-Cureton (9th) and
Olivia McClintock (10th) finish inside the top 10.
-
Haley Faulkner continued her momentum from indoor season, breaking the 400-meter school record (59.57) with a sixth-place finish.
- In the distance events,
Lydia Slemp established two new program records in the 800 meters (2:26.12) and 1500 meters (4:54.03), finishing eighth in the 1500.
- The hurdles group was led by
Jocie Aldrich, who set a school record in the 100-meter hurdles (16.35) and added another record in the 400-meter hurdles (1:11.36), placing eighth in the event.
- The women's 4x100-meter relay team of Sutherland, Ansley-Cureton, Faulkner, and McClintock delivered a standout performance, setting a school record (48.73) while finishing third overall.
- In the field events,
Lexi Carter set a school record in the shot put (13.21m) with a fourth-place finish, while also adding a top-10 mark in the hammer throw.
Nia Rogers contributed depth in both events, finishing sixth in the hammer and seventh in the shot put.
- In the jumps, Aldrich tied the school record in the triple jump (10.87m) with a sixth-place finish, while
Kylie Brodt (9th) and
Braelynn Strouth (10th) added additional top-10 performances.
Fairyn Meares also placed eighth in the pole vault to round out a balanced women's performance.
MEN'S HIGHLIGHTS
- The Cavalier men matched that momentum with a series of school records and top-10 finishes, particularly in the middle distance, jumps, and throws.
-
Jonah Adams led the way on the track, breaking the school record in the 800 meters (1:57.20) with a sixth-place finish, and adding a 10th-place finish in the 1500 meters.
- In the distance events,
Caleb Ghammashi set a school record in the 10,000 meters (36:24.86), finishing 10th.
- The jumps group saw continued progression, as
Henry McFarlin set a school record in the triple jump (12.73m) while placing sixth, and added a top-10 finish in the long jump. In the high jump,
Bennett Estremera cleared 1.90m to place fifth.
- In the pole vault, freshman David Williams led the group with a fifth-place finish (4.00m), while
Hunter Garrett (7th) also finished in the top 10.
- The throws unit delivered one of the strongest performances of the meet.
Bobby Cline set a school record in the hammer throw (50.31m) while finishing third, and added a seventh-place finish in the javelin.
-
Ronald Gray added a school record in the discus (45.92m) with a fourth-place finish, while
Landon Steele (8th) also scored a top-10 finish in the event.
